High Flood Risk

High flood risk in Caramoan is a serious consideration for buyers in San Roque. During typhoon season, significant flooding can occur. Key questions to ask before buying: Which months does this street flood? What is the average water depth? Has interior flooding ever occurred? How long does water typically take to recede?

Can I operate a business from a property in San Roque, Caramoan?

Running a business from a residential property in San Roque requires a barangay business permit and compliance with Caramoan's zoning regulations. Light commercial use (sari-sari store, home office, small service business) is generally permitted in residential zones with the appropriate permits. For larger commercial or industrial operations, verify the lot's zoning classification at Caramoan's CPDO before purchasing.

Is San Roque zoned residential or commercial?

Zoning for San Roque is defined by Caramoan's Comprehensive Land Use Plan (CLUP). Most barangays have mixed residential-commercial zoning along main roads and residential zoning for interior streets. Verify the specific lot's zoning classification at the Caramoan CPDO (City/Municipal Planning and Development Office) before purchasing, especially if you intend to operate a business.
